PURPOSE: Venous thromboembolism (VTE) is a preventable condition associated with an increased risk of morbidity and mortality in hospitalized patients. Pharmacological and/or mechanical prophylaxis can prevent thromboembolism events. Guidelines recommend the use of scores for risk assessment in hospitalized patients. These scores are based on a variety of risk factors, including age, reduced mobility, and type of surgery. They help determine the most appropriate prophylaxis method for each patient. However, VTE prophylaxis is still a challenge, and there are limitations associated with it. In this scenario, clinical pharmacists may play a key role in improving VTE prophylaxis. The main aim of this real-life study was to evaluate the contribution of the clinical pharmacist to thromboembolism prophylaxis in a large sample of clinical and surgical patients. METHODS: This is an observational and retrospective study using hospital-based data. The study included 4031 patients, and we evaluated how pharmacist interventions contributed to the appropriate indication and correct use of VTE prophylaxis in clinical and surgical patients. We included 1093 clinical patients and 2938 surgical patients. RESULTS: Following clinical pharmacist involvement (262 pharmacist interventions), there were improvements in the adequacy rate: 62.0% for clinical patients and 55.0% for surgical patients. CONCLUSION: The intervention of the clinical pharmacist can contribute to improved rates of adherence to VTE protocols.
